Squee Posted September 15, 2011 Author Posted September 15, 2011 Finally an update! I had my Zed in at Middlehurst Nissan this week and whilst the head technician was looking at it I asked his opinion on the bump/dint and scratch. His opinion is that at some stage something rather heavy landed on the bonnet which was filled and resprayed and, as the scratch appeared on a very hot day, the heat expanded and cracked. Will hopefully be getting a respray within the next couple of months. Just in time for the winter S. Quote
